OK, I've seen several people say that they are looking forward to the new LOS rules in RoR.

Most of the battles I play don't seem to have hills or forests, so I'm having a hard time figuring out why I should get all excited about this...

Will the new LOS rules allow me to shoot over intervening units, or why should I really care?

Depends on how they are implemented.

Yes, they should at least prohibit units from firing at BGs that they cannot see, such as on the other side of hills or forests. However, I'm hoping that they will provide an element of Fog of War by 'hiding' enemy BGs from the player until such time as at least one friendly unit has LoS.

In that way, even on a relatively flat battlefield, some enemy BGs will potentially be 'hidden' behind other enemy BGs. So, allied with a free setup, you will not know exactly where all the enemy BGs are setup at the start. Throw in a few hills or forests and you may have only a sketchy view of enemy dispositions. Imagine the possibilities for ambushes in hilly country or hiding the fact that you have put all your cavalry on the left wing hiding behind a line of other BGs.

We shall just have to wait and see how Slitherine intends the LoS rules to work.
